Project overview

Client

Australian National University

Value

$9M

Completion

2010

Builder

Hindmarsh Construction Australia

Architect

William Ross Architects

Donald Cant Watts Corke provided Quantity Surveying services to the Australian National University in ACT, for the Fenner School and Climate Change Institute Building.

The building has a number of sustainability features to achieve 6 Star Green Star Design and As Built ratings.
